PCBs and the Environment.


COM7210419

Publication Date 1972
Page Count 194
Abstract The report is the product of a six month review of the chemicals known as PCBs--polychlorinated biphenyls--by five Federal agencies, with participation by other agencies. The task force made nine findings, conclusions, and recommendations, primarily pointing out that PCBs should be restricted to essential or nonreplaceable uses which would minimize the likelihood of human exposure or leakage to the environment. Supplementing the 20-page report are eight appendices detailing current knowledge about various aspects of PCBs, including their use and replaceability; occurrence, transfer, and cycling in the environment; occurrence and sources in food; and PCBs effects on man and animals.
